    A pit can be dug by 4 men in 16 days. How many days will 8 men take for the same work?

    An inlet pipe fills a cistern in 3 hours. However, due to leakage at the bottom, it takes half an hour longer. When the cistern is full, how long would the leak take to empty the cistern?

    A contractor undertakes a certain work to be completed in 55 days and employs 48 men to do it. In 11 days, only 1/6th of the work has been done. How many extra men should he employ in order to complete the work in the allotted time?

    How many patients does the doctor examine in a day if he examines 5 patients in 3 hours with breaks of 10 minutes between two consecutive patients and he works for 10 hours and 15 minutes per day?

    A alone can do a piece of work in 6 days and B alone can do it in 8 days. How many days will it take both A and B together to finish twice the same work?

    If 10 men can clean 2 acres of lawn in 12 days, then how many men can clean 3 acres of lawn in 6 days?

    When sugar is 10 kg for Rs. 100, a sum of money maintains a family of 18 men for 15 days. How long will the same amount of money maintain a family of 6 men when sugar is 14 kg for Rs. 100?

    A and B together can do a piece of work in 12 days, B and C together can do that work in 18 days, and A and C together can do the same work in 36 days. In how many days can they do five times the same work if all of them work together?

    A and B can do a piece of work in 30 days, while B and C can do the same work in 24 days and C and A in 20 days. They all work for 10 days, then B and C leave. How many more days will A take to finish the work?

    If 5 men or 9 women can do a piece of work in 19 days, how long will it take to complete the same work with 3 men and 6 women?

    One tap can fill a cistern in 2 hours and another tap can empty the cistern in 3 hours. How long will it take to fill the cistern if both the taps are opened?

    A tank can be emptied by three taps in 3 hours. The first tap alone can empty it in 6 hours and second tap alone can empty it in 9 hours. How many hours will the third tap alone take to empty the tank?

    Two pipes A and B would fill a cistern in 37 min and 45 min, respectively. If both the pipes are opened, when should the second pipe be turned off so that the cistern may be filled in half an hour?

    A pumping set of 1.5 kilowatts (kW) can raise 1500 litres of water from a well of certain depth in certain time. A pumping set of how many kilowatts (kW) is needed to raise 4500 litres of water from the well of the same depth and in the same time?

    If two pipes function simultaneously, the reservoir will be filled in 12 hours. The first pipe fills the reservoir 10 hours faster than the other. How many hours will the second pipe take to fill the reservoir?

    Eina, Mina and Dika are three carpenters. They take a contract and start simultaneously to finish this task. Mina can finish the work in 16 days; Eina is twice as much efficient as Mina, whereas Dika is as much efficient as Mina. Eina and Mina leave after 2 and 4 days, respectively. How many more days will Dika take to finish the work?

    20 men could do a piece of work in 30 days working 4 hours a day, 30 men worked for 20 days for 3 hours a day. Then all were laid off, except one. How many more days would it take the last man to complete the remaining work, working 10 hours a day?

    It was estimated that 20 men would complete a work in 50 days working for 5 hours a day. But after 15 days from the start of work, 10 men dropped out of work. How many hours per day did the remaining men have to work to complete the work on time?

    A and B worked together and completed a work in 24 days. They got some money for their work. If they distribute that money according to their work, A would get 50% more money than B. In how many days could B alone complete the work?
